National Call a Friend Day is observed worldwide every December 28. This unofficial holiday encourages people to reach out to friends they haven't spoken to in a while, promoting the benefits of voice communication over messaging. Although the origins of the holiday are unclear, it is celebrated at a time when many people are busy with year-end activities, making it a perfect opportunity to connect and share pleasant experiences. Psychological organizations and therapists support this observance, highlighting the positive impact of talking to friends on mental health. Typical customs include making phone calls or video chats, organizing group calls, and even initiating a "pay it forward" approach by encouraging friends to call others. Participants are also encouraged to share their experiences on social media using the hashtags #NationalCallAFriendDay and #CallAFriendDay.
